About Seaforth 2092

The size of Seaforth is approximately 3.0 square kilometres. There are 15 parks, covering nearly 17.5% of the total area. The population of Seaforth in 2016 was 7139 people. By 2021 the population was 7384 showing a population growth of 3.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Seaforth is 10-19 years. Households in Seaforth are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Seaforth work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 82.20% of the homes in Seaforth were owner-occupied compared with 81.40% in 2016.

Seaforth has 2,827 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Seaforth have seen a 15.45%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 14.08%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Seaforth is $3,842,867 while the median value for Units is $2,111,462.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,850 while Units have a median rent of $1,100.
